I have zero doubts that a 7th season will happen ... Sutter signed a three year deal with FX (http://www.deadline.com/2012/02/sons...or-6th-season/), and the ratings are crazy for a cable-show: the first episode of the 5th season drew over 5 million viewers, which was the highest rating in the history of FX. The average of the 5th season is nearly 4.5 million viewers and the share in the 18-49 group has been sensational.
